Output 77368df62c86cdff4e9562df1ddf760ef1bb6f8822f691fdb30c6d11a336e618:1

value
12389075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83f552f3719079fb5f5857d0717c9d5071553c86 OP_EQUALVERIFY OP_CHECKSIG
address
1D2jQYSMBcjVhymotcvQpsNEf2v3LbKUcG
transaction
77368df62c86cdff4e9562df1ddf760ef1bb6f8822f691fdb30c6d11a336e618
confirmations
355601
spent
true